Spacious, sunny, south-facing top-floor one bedroom apartment for rent. Updated throughout the open floor plan. Both the bedroom and the main living area are well-proportioned with plenty of room for a home office setup in either room (or multiple home offices). It is the closest apartment to a generously-sized shared roof deck. The large bathroom has an in-unit washer and dryer. The bedroom, on the southwest corner, has windows on two sides, while a bank of oversized windows in the living/dining area let in plenty of light, even on cloudy days. And blackout shades mean you can keep the light out when you want to. Two big closets, a freestanding armoire, and a built-in bookshelf give you plenty of storage space. The open kitchen with a custom-built island will be great for entertaining, as the city opens back up. In the meanwhile, you're a very short walk to the large green space of Rock Creek Park, and smaller spaces of Kalorama Park and Meridian Hill. The location is central: the U street corridor, Dupont Circle, and Adams Morgan's shops on 18th Street are all blocks away. The building, built in 1908, is historic and neighborly. DC's best Eritrean restaurant and hamburger joints are across the street, and because the apartment is set back from both 18th Street and Florida you are insulated from street noise while keeping all the convenience of being in the middle of one of the city's very best neighborhoods. Renter responsible for electricity and internet. The unit has its own heating and A/C system. There is no gas. Water is included in the rent, as part of the homeowner's association fee, which is also included. Sorry, no pets, and no smoking. There is no parking place but street parking, with a resident's permit, is generally quite easy.
